The term "CVS MySchedule" refers exclusively to the internal workforce management and scheduling portal used by CVS Health employees. This platform is not a public-facing service for pharmacy patients or retail customers.



Understanding the Role of the MySchedule Portal in 2026

For the CVS Health workforce, the MySchedule portal serves as the primary digital interface for managing operational hours, shift assignments, and labor optimization. As of 2026, the system has been integrated into the broader CVS Health Hub infrastructure, utilizing advanced algorithmic scheduling to align store labor hours with peak pharmacy demand and retail foot traffic.

The primary objective of this system is to ensure that pharmacy technicians, pharmacists, and retail associates are deployed efficiently. By analyzing real-time data points such as prescription volume, vaccine administration surges, and seasonal retail activity, the portal generates dynamic schedules that aim to maintain service level agreements while adhering to state-specific labor laws and corporate workforce regulations.

Core Features and Functionalities for Staff

The 2026 iteration of MySchedule offers enhanced self-service capabilities. Employees are empowered to view their upcoming shifts, submit time-off requests, and engage in shift swaps within the parameters set by their store managers.



  1. Shift Management: Real-time visibility into weekly and bi-weekly schedules.
  2. Preference Submission: Ability to input availability changes, which the system then reconciles against the needs of the business.
  3. Shift Swapping: A formalized digital process where employees can trade shifts, pending managerial approval, ensuring that coverage is never compromised.
  4. Labor Analytics: Real-time feedback for management regarding store performance versus scheduled hours, allowing for mid-week adjustments.

Troubleshooting Common Access Disruptions

Technological friction within the portal is typically resolved by verifying network connectivity or clearing local browser cache files. If a user encounters a "403 Forbidden" or "Authentication Error," the following hierarchy of troubleshooting steps should be applied:



  • Clear Browser Data: Ensure that all cookies and cached files related to the specific internal portal domain are cleared.
  • VPN Validation: If accessing remotely, confirm that the corporate VPN client is updated to the 2026 version. Outdated clients are frequently blocked by updated server-side firewalls.
  • Browser Compatibility: Use only the enterprise-approved browsers. While some mobile functionality is supported, certain administrative functions are restricted to desktop environments for security compliance.
  • Managerial Intervention: If the portal indicates an "Access Denied" status despite correct credentials, the store manager must verify that the employee’s status is active within the HR Information System (HRIS).


Adherence to Workforce Regulatory Standards

In 2026, labor law compliance remains a cornerstone of the MySchedule system. The platform is configured to prevent the scheduling of shifts that would violate state-specific mandates regarding mandatory meal breaks, rest periods, and maximum consecutive work hours. The system automatically triggers alerts if a proposed schedule conflicts with these legal requirements, forcing a manual review by store leadership.

Pharmacy operations face additional rigor; the system is designed to ensure that a licensed pharmacist is physically present during all hours the pharmacy is operational. The scheduling algorithm automatically cross-references the pharmacy's operating hours with the licensure status of the staff to ensure constant compliance with Board of Pharmacy regulations in every jurisdiction.
